Output 5965145a4b68ad05a5ebd6d2fa3368b025a29f0775301d6e5299e02f5de5e145:2

value
22683173
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6bac804c067001da28b9ac6d0cab1355300b1258 OP_EQUAL
address
3BWLsfFc5vWEP5HcUSJg9qAb3fefpk7Bep
transaction
5965145a4b68ad05a5ebd6d2fa3368b025a29f0775301d6e5299e02f5de5e145
spent
true